    Who is Dr. Breen, Pulmonologist in Pittsgrove, NJ?

    Dr. Gregory Breen, MD is a Pulmonologist, who primarily practices in Pittsgrove, NJ with 2 additional practice locations. He has been practicing for over 25 years. Dr. Breen graduated from MCP HAHNEMANN UNIV (FORMERLY ALLEGHENY UNIV) and completed his residency at Allegheny Gen Hospital. Dr. Breen is fluent in English and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Breen’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Gregory Breen's specialty?

    Dr. Breen is a Pulmonologist near Pittsgrove, NJ. An internist specializing in the treatment of lung and airway diseases. The pulmonologist diagnoses and manages conditions such as cancer, pneumonia, pleurisy, asthma, occupational and environmental illnesses, bronchitis, sleep disorders, emphysema, and other complex lung disorders.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
